After completing the experiment, Kendall wants to see if the difference between the averages for the control and treatment groups was due to the treatment or not. To investigate this, she performs a significance test. The first step is to do a simulation using the data. She randomly reorganizes all of the data into two groups, A and B, each of size 25. In this simulation, group A plays the role of the treatment group and group B plays the role of the control group. Group A: quiz scores 63 79 72 69 68 72 69 73 72 77 84 83 71 74 80 84 63 79 77 78 73 83 72 72 75 Mean: 74.48 Group B: quiz scores 68 88 79 62 84 71 72 61 71 76 79 77 73 87 88 72 81 80 60 84 80 70 89 81 69 Mean: 76.08 Remember that the average for the treatment group was 2.4 higher than the average for the control group in the original experiment. Kendall wants to compare this with the simulation results. So, she subtracts the average for group B from the average for group A. What is this value?
